At the end of this week I will start bringing my girl back into work. She has had about 8 weeks off with a very sore back and lame leg. Detailed investigations including scans have not brought up a thing and vets recommended to give her 6 weeks off then start bringing into work (no rider for initial 2-3 weeks) - and see if she is better...

I want to assume she is going to be ok if I introduce things slowly and continue to be careful with her, so I am not expecting her to have a knackering work schedule when back in shape, just light work including schooling and hacking mainly.

Now, she has been off work for the past 8 weeks, been in hospital at the start for 10 days on box rest then turned out and for the last 6 weeks been living out 24/7.
How would you start working her? Vet recommended lungeing with a pessoa during the initial 2 weeks. BUt, although I have one and like it, I think I don't want to use it at the start but later on when she is more used to working again as it can be a bit rigid. So I thought of getting out my two lunge lines and do some long lining first. But how much should i be asking, 10mins, 20mins, 30mins each time, and what pace? I am thinking of doing up to 5 days of some work with her and give 2 days off. How much shall I ask in terms of "working correctly" - surely not very much at first? I really want to get this right. Any ideas for a varied programme that gradually builds her up?

If she's been living out she will have been using her muscles walking around, so you don't have to worry TOO much about a short start off - 15 mins of walking on the long reins building up to half hour for couple of weeks, nothing too strenuous. Introduce short trots after couple of weeks, building up work and pace very slowly - playing it by ear and seeing what vet thinks.. fingers crossed.x
